Error description
This APAR makes multiple changes to the IBM HTTP Server powered by Apache for DGW compatibility: 1) Set DOCUMENT_ROOT to the dirname of the requested cgi file 2) Set DOCUMENT_ROOT and DOCUMENT_NAME in CGI scripts, rather than only in serverside-included files 3) Prevent mod_dir from changing DOCUMENT_URI to the DirectoryIndex

Problem summary
**************************************************************** * USERS AFFECTED: Users of Domino Go webserver who are * * migrating to IBM HTTP Server powered by * * Apache. * **************************************************************** * PROBLEM DESCRIPTION: The values of the DOCUMENT_ROOT, * * DOCUMENT_NAME, and DOCUMENT_URI CGI * * and SSI variables differ between DGW * * and IHS. * **************************************************************** * RECOMMENDATION: Apply this fix. * **************************************************************** The DOCUMENT_* variables differ in these four ways: - DOCUMENT_ROOT holds the parent directory of the requested file in DGW, whereas it is equal to the value of DocumentRoot in IHS. - DOCUMENT_NAME holds the full path to the file in DGW, whereas in IHS it contains only the name of the file. - DOCUMENT_NAME and DOCUMENT_ROOT are set within both SSIs and CGIs in DGW, but they are set only in SSIs in IHS. - When the index of a directory is requested (e.g. /), in DGW, DOCUMENT_URI holds the original URI of the request, whereas IHS holds the mapped URI (e.g. /index.html).
Problem conclusion
Four directives have been added to correct each of the differences listed in the problem summary, and one directive has been added to set all four flags at once. The four directives corresponding to the four differences in the problem summary are: - CGISetDocumentRootToDirname - CGISetDocumentNameToFullPath - CGISetDocumentVars - CGIDocumentURIIgnoreDirectoryIndex The overriding directive to set all four at once is "DGWScriptCompat", which may be updated to also toggle other compatibility options in the future.
